Roof drain repl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ged roof drainage components and installing new systems that effectively manage rainwater runoff. This process typically includes removing old gutters, downspouts, or internal drainage pipes, inspecting the roof and underlying structure, and then installing new, properly fitted drainage solutions. These upgrades help ensure that rainwater is directed away from the roof and foundation, reducing the risk of water-related damage and maintaining the integrity of the property.
Many property owners turn to roof drain replacement when they notice issues such as overflowing gutters, water pooling on the roof, or leaks inside the building. These problems often stem from clogged, cracked, or improperly functioning drains that no longer direct water efficiently. Replacing damaged or outdated roof drains can solve these issues, preventing water from seeping into the roof structure, causing rot, mold, or structural deterioration. It’s a practical step to protect the property’s long-term stability and avoid costly repairs down the line.

The overview below groups typical Roof Drain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Hickory,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or roof drain repairs in Hickory, NC range from $250-$600.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and materials involved.
Partial Replacement - Replacing sections of roof drains generally costs between $1,000-$3,000. Larger projects with more extensive work tend to approach the upper end of this range, but most fall in the middle.
Full Roof Drain Replacement - Complete replacement of roof drainage systems can cost from $3,500-$8,000, with more complex or larger roofs reaching higher prices. Many projects in this category are priced toward the middle or upper-middle of this range.
Complex or Large-Scale Projects - Extensive or custom drain replacement jobs, especially on commercial roofs, can exceed $10,000. These projects are less common and typically involve higher material and labor costs due to complexity.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that roof drains need replacement? Indicators include persistent leaks, water pooling on the roof, or visible damage to the drain components that cannot be repaired effectively.
How do local contractors typically replace roof drains? They assess the existing drainage system, remove damaged parts, and install new, properly fitted roof drains to ensure effective water flow.
Are roof drain replacements necessary for all types of roofs? Not necessarily; the need depends on the roof's age, condition, and drainage system. A professional inspection can determine if replacement is recommended.
What materials are commonly used for roof drain replacements? Common materials include PVC, cast iron, and aluminum, chosen based on the roof type and local building codes.
Can roof drain replacement help prevent water damage? Yes, replacing faulty or damaged roof drains can improve water runoff and reduce the risk of leaks and water-related damage to the building.
